参照:http://www.cnblogs.com/forlina/archive/2011/06/27/2091105.html
1、核心意图:
将一个类的接口转换成客户希望的另外一个接口,从而使得原本由于接口不兼容而不能一起工作的类可以一起工作。
该模式的目标是通过一个代理(这里是Adapter),在原来的类(Adaptee)和客户(Client)之间进行协调,从而达到兼容的目的。其核心是解决一致性的问题。
1. uml
案例:
http://blog.youkuaiyun.com/adoocoke/article/details/8286902